C语言程序题目:由键盘输入三个数a,b,c,按从小到大的顺序输出这三...
a,b,c);return0;}这个程序的核心思想是,通过使用if-else语句,首先比较b和a的大小,如果b小于a,就交换它们的值。然后,再比较c与a和b的大小,根据需要进行相应交换,确保最终输出的数总是按照升序排列。
Console.WriteLine(这三个数从小到大是{0},{1},{2}, c, b, a);} } 1.C语言中用来表示整型常量的进制是 (int),(LongInt)(shotInt) 一个函数由两部分组成,它们是(函数名)和(函数体)。 C的字符串常量是用()括起来的字符序列。
if ac 将a和c对换 (a是a,c中的小者,因此a是三者中最小者)。if bc 将b和c对换 (b是b,c中的小者,也是三者中次小者)。
在编程中,使用C语言处理三个整数的排序是一个常见的练习。首先,我们需要从用户那里读取三个整数。然后,通过一系列的条件判断和值交换,我们可以确保这三个数按从小到大的顺序排列。最后,程序将输出排序后的结果。
设计一个C语言程序,目的是从键盘上输入三个整数a, b, c,然后找出并输出这三个数中的最小值。具体实现步骤如下:首先,在程序的最开始部分,我们需要包含必要的头文件,并定义主函数main。这里我们使用头文件,用于输入输出操作。
如何通过c语言编程输出三个数的排序?
思路:求三个数x,y,z的大小顺序,可以先比较x和y的大小,把大值赋值x,小值赋值给y,接着比较x和z,把大值赋值x,小值赋值给z,则x为最大值,最后比较y和z的大小,把大值赋值给y,小值赋值给z,则z为最小值,x,y,z就是从大到小的顺序。
} 在这个程序中,我们首先定义了一个宏“swap”,用于交换两个变量的值。接着,我们通过`scanf`函数读取用户输入的三个整数。接下来的条件语句确保了`a`是三个数中最小的一个,`b`是中间值,`c`是最大的。最后,通过`printf`函数输出排序后的结果。
思路:如果利用if进行三个数a,b,b的排序,则先利用if判断a和b的大小,把小数赋值给a大数赋值给b,再利用if判断c和b的大小,把小数赋值给b大数赋值给c,则c就是最大值,最后比较a和b的大小,把小数赋值给a大数赋值给b,则a就是最小数,b是中间值,输出a,b,c就是排序后数。
三个if是并列的关系 程序的功能是三个数里面两两比较,从小到达一次排序。
if bc 将b和c对换 (b是b,c中的小者,也是三者中次小者)。
C语言如何从键盘输入任意3个数,按从小到大的顺序输出?
在这个程序中,我们首先定义了一个宏“swap”,用于交换两个变量的值。接着,我们通过`scanf`函数读取用户输入的三个整数。接下来的条件语句确保了`a`是三个数中最小的一个,`b`是中间值,`c`是最大的。最后,通过`printf`函数输出排序后的结果。这个简单的程序可以帮助初学者理解如何在C语言中进行基本的数据排序。
结论是,这篇文章提供了一个C语言程序,用于接收用户输入的三个数a、b和c,并按从小到大的顺序输出。
这篇文章主要介绍了如何使用C语言中的指针方法,按照字符串的字典序,将用户输入的三个字符串strstr2和str0按从小到大的顺序输出。
t=a;a=c;c=t;if(bc)t=b;b=c;c=t;printf(%d ,%d ,%d\n,a,b,c);} 算法思想:先拿a分别和b,c做比较,如果a比它们大,就把两个数的会值换过来(通过中间变量t),确保a是最小的,接下来比较b和c,如果bc则把bc的值互换,确保bc。接下来按次序打印a,b,c。
编写一个程序,输入a,b,c三个值,按从小到大的顺序输出。
if bc 将b和c对换 (b是b,c中的小者,也是三者中次小者)。
求教一道c语言编程题:输入三个整数,从大到小排序,并输出这三个数
思路:求三个数x,y,z的大小顺序,可以先比较x和y的大小,把大值赋值x,小值赋值给y,接着比较x和z,把大值赋值x,小值赋值给z,则x为最大值,最后比较y和z的大小,把大值赋值给y,小值赋值给z,则z为最小值,x,y,z就是从大到小的顺序。
在编程中,使用C语言处理三个整数的排序是一个常见的练习。首先,我们需要从用户那里读取三个整数。然后,通过一系列的条件判断和值交换,我们可以确保这三个数按从小到大的顺序排列。最后,程序将输出排序后的结果。
if ac 将a和c对换 (a是a,c中的小者,因此a是三者中最小者)。if bc 将b和c对换 (b是b,c中的小者,也是三者中次小者)。